Nokia and Windows Phone continue to surge towards rejoining the smartphone elite fleet with their third, latest smartphone; Lumia 900, which has 4G on board for the US market.

The success of the Windows Phone platform is good for the smart phone industry, offering a clear way out from the Android or Apple monopoly for the users. It should be the Nokia's biggest smartphone launch in the country to date. According to one report, Nokia, Microsoft and AT&T will spend roughly $100 million marketing the phone.

Lumia 900, is a smartphone that comes with a 4.3-inch AMLOED display with Cornering Gorilla Glass and Nokia ClearBlack technology. 16GB of internal flash storage, 512MB of RAM, and a single-core 1.4GHz Scorpion CPU mounted on the Qualcomm’s APQ8055 Snapdragon chipset.

Nokia Lumia 900 also have 8MP camera with autofocus, dual LED flash and Carl Zeiss’ lenses. With support for HD 720p video recording and a resolution of 3264×2448 pixels Lumia 900′s optic unit is almost everything you’d want from a phone camera.

It is also pre-loaded with Microsoft’s latest mobile OS, Windows Phone 7.5.


When it comes to connectivity, the high-end smart phone of the Nokia Lumia line-up comes with HSDPA (21 Mbps) and HSUPA (5.76 Mbps), WiFi 802.11 b/g/n, Bluetooth v2.1, microUSB v2.0, NFC chip and, of course, 4G LTE support.

According to a leaked roadmap published at BGR, the Lumia 900 will launch on March 18, for $100 with a two-year contract.

Every 10-13 January at the Consumer Electronics Show in Las Vegas is the place to be for consumer electronics companies to unveil their upcoming products for the year. This year LG Electronics plans to show the world's largest OLED TV - a 55-inch display that's just 4 mm thin and weighs a mere 7.5 kg.

The new High Definition Television (HDTV) uses advanced OLED (Organic Light-Emitting Diode) technology with "4-Color Pixels and Color Refiner" features that generate natural, accurate colors without jaggies and other imperfections. With the 4-Color Pixels feature, each pixel uses a set of four colors - red, green, blue and white - which expands on the common RGB (red, green, blue) setup.

According to LG, the TV is also 1,000 times faster than the normal LED / LCD tv displays.



The advantages of an OLED television are:

  • Light weight & flexible plastic substrates
  • Wider viewing angles & improved brightness
  • Better power efficiency
  • Faster response time

The Korean consumer electronics manufacturer will also unveil its 84-inch Ultra Definition set, which has 8 million pixels at CES.

Although microchip giant Intel on Monday have announced that it expects to badly miss their sales forecast for the current quarter caused by lower sales of notebook computers and desktops due to the hard drive shortage caused by the massive floods in Thailand, Hitachi have released their new 4TB Deskstar hard drive for internal and Touro Desk for external use.

Users will get a free 3GB of cloud storage from HitachiBackup.com with every purchase of the Touro Desk external hard drive.

This is the world first commercially available at that storage capacity. Granted it's not the fastest hard drive available by running at 5900 rpm, or what the Hitachi calls "CoolSpin" resulting in the drive having up to 28 percent idle power savings compared to the 7200 rpm drives.

The massive storage of their new 4TB hard drive is sure to please a lot of users with massive files with it's gigantic storage and USB 3.0 capability.

It's currently priced at 26,800 Yen ($345), but currently there's no official announcement from Hitachi for it's international availability and the Thailand floods will likely mean it's very low on stock.

According to eMarketer, by the end of this year, it is estimated that 33.7 million people in the United States will be using a tablet pc thanks to the main leader of pc tablet, the Apple iPad.

The growth of tablet users in the last year has been up by over 158% since December of last year, the first iPad was released.


By the end of 2014, it is predicted almost 90 million people will be using a tablet pc. They believe that tablets will eventually be a personal necessity like smart phone these days.

Apple is currently keeping the majority share of the tablet market with HP TouchPad and Kindle ebook reader way behind, eMarketer predicts that the iPad will have a 68% market share.


Women, who happens to have less than 50% of the tablet pc are expected to pull even with men. By the end of 2011, youths under the age of 18 will own 13% of the pc tablet. That will increase to 15.9% in 3 years.

NVIDIA have introduced it's long-awaited Tegra 3 processor (Formerly Known As Kal-El), which is the first quad-core mobile processor ever released.

Mainly designed for the pc tablet , latest cell phones and smart phones , the Tegra 3 will purportedly best the processing performance of the older Tegra 2 chip by a factor of five (and graphics by a factor of three, thanks to it's 12-core NVIDIA GeForce GPU with stereo 3D support), all while reducing power consumption by 61%.



Although Tegra 3 is a quad-core chip, there is also a fifth "companion core", which is designed to take over for less-intensive computing tasks, such as listening to audio or web browsing. The technology behind the fifth core is NVIDIA’s Variable Symmetric Multiprocessing (vSMP).

With the new Tegra 3, users can expect everything on their mobile devices to perform faster and better, including web browsing experience, gaming, streaming video, video edditing and running apps.
